Corn Upma | Kerala Style Cholam Upma
A traditional preparation from Kerala that balances flavour, texture, and aroma in the way that only home cooking can. No two households make it exactly the same, and that is the point.
Ingredientsfor 4 servings
- 2 cup Corn rava
- 1 nos Onion
- 1 tbsp Oil
- 1 tsp Mustard seeds
- Curry leaves, a few
- Salt, to taste
- 2 nos Green chilly
Preparation
Step 1
Gather and prep all your ingredients before you begin.
Step 2
Steam cook the corn rava by adding 3/4 cup water for about 10-15 minutes.
Step 3
Pour oil into a pan and heat it, add mustard seeds, let it allow to crackle, then add onions. cook until transparent and add required salt.
Step 4
Next, add chopped green chilly and curry leaves. stir for a few seconds.
Step 5
Finally add steamed corn rava and mix it well. Keep stirring for 5 minutes. Sprinkle some water only if needed. Reduce the flame, Put the lid on and let it go for 2 more minutes.
Step 6
Easy and healthy Corn Upma is ready to serve.
